Stocks
Rupee holds the key to the market
THE markets are tipped to move sideways in the week ahead with selective buying in old economy stocks. Going by a week-on-week basis, the BSE Sensex could move in a band of 3,800 points to 4,200 points. The Sensex closed at 4,084.71 points last week.
